Luxury garden suite with hot tub close to the 2010 Olympic and Paralympics Venue, close to downtown, airport and other exciting Vancouver attractions. The Main St. Vineyard suite is a 500 square foot custom designed garden suite located steps from funky Main Street. This neighborhood is teeming with funky restaurants, antique shops, live music, great shopping and is on all major bus routes.

We are 5 minute cab ride to our new Canada Line Rapid transit, which connects Vancouver Airport and downtown. We are a 15 minute cab ride direct to airport and the main train station.

The suite is located in a brand new custom designed home with all modern amenities like radiant floor heating, wireless internet and custom designed garden, which features a hot tub, expansive cedar deck, BBQ, pocket vineyard and luxury outdoor furniture.

You will be within an easy 5 minute walk of: The shops, coffee hoses, live music venues and bars of Main Street, Queen Elizabeth Park, the 2010 Olympic Curling facility, Riley Park Community Center and Vancouver Racquets Club.

15 – 20 minute drive from: Vancouver International Airport, Ballantyne Cruise Ship Pier, Vancouver Convention Center, University of British Columbia, Wreck Beach, English Bay, Stanley Park, Vancouver Aquarium, Pacific Center Mall, GM Place, BC Place, Gastown, Chinatown, Science World.

For culturally minded guests, Vancouver has world class theatre, music and arts including the UBC museum of Anthropology and Vancouver Art gallery.

For sports minded, we have great cycling, hiking, kayaking and golf all within a short distance and a 40 minute drive to 3 local ski areas such as Cypress Mountain, which will host the 2010 Olympic freestyle, moguls and snowboard events. We are a 2 hr drive to Whistler/Blackcomb, the number one ski resort in North America and host to all the main 2010 Olympic skiing events and 1 hour drive to world class Rock Climbing and Mountain Biking and Wind Surfing in Squamish. We are a half hour drive to the world famous North Shore Mountain Bike trails. For those who enjoy watching sports, we have professional soccer, hockey, baseball and football teams in Vancouver.
